رسا چیست؟ راهنمای مبتدیان برای هوش مصنوعی مکالمه

در روند امروزی، رباتهای چت و دستیاران مجازی برای بهبود خدمات مشتری، کاهش هزینهها و ارائه پشتیبانی 24 ساعته به یک ابزار ضروری برای مشاغل تبدیل شدهاند. موارد استفاده رایج برای این رباتها پاسخ به سؤالات متداول، انجام گردشهای کاری معمول یا اقدامات مورد نیاز است. اما ساخت این عوامل مکالمه می تواند پیچیده باشد زیرا برای ساختن آن به ابزارهای مناسب نیاز داریم. اینجاست که رسا وارد بازی می شود. بیایید شیرجه بزنیم!
رسا چیست؟
Rasa یک چارچوب متن باز برای ساخت هوش مصنوعی محاوره ای از جمله چت بات ها و دستیاران مجازی است. برخلاف رباتهای چت معمولی، Rasa به توسعهدهندگان این آزادی را میدهد تا سیستمهای هوش مصنوعی بسیار قابل تنظیم و متناسب با نیازهای خاص را ایجاد کنند.
با رسا می توانید سیستم های گفتگوی هوشمند و تعاملی طراحی کنید. چه در حال ساخت یک ربات پرسشهای متداول ساده یا یک دستیار پیچیده باشید که قادر به مکالمات چند نوبتی است، Rasa ابزارهایی را برای تحقق آن فراهم میکند.
چرا راسا را انتخاب کنید؟
در اینجا چند دلیل برای برجسته شدن راسا آورده شده است:
-
منبع باز: Rasa برای استفاده رایگان است و به شما کنترل کامل روی کد ربات چت خود را می دهد.
-
**قابل تنظیم:** رفتار ربات خود را طوری تنظیم کنید که نیازهای منحصر به فرد شما را برآورده کند.
-
** مقیاس پذیر: ** ساخت ربات هایی که می توانند هزاران کاربر را مدیریت کنند.
-
**جامعه محور:** با حمایت یک جامعه فعال و هزاران سند برای شروع.
-
**پشتیبانی چند زبانه:** دستیارهایی را به زبان دلخواه خود ایجاد کنید.
اجزای رسا
رسا دو جزء اصلی دارد:
1. طعم منبع باز
این قلب چارچوب است، جایی که همه جادوها اتفاق می افتد. این یک چارچوب مبتنی بر یادگیری ماشینی است که به توسعه دهندگان اجازه می دهد:
-
اهداف را تعریف کنید (مثلاً «امروز هوا چطور است؟»)
-
مدلهای قطار برای درک زبان طبیعی (NLU)
-
خط مشی های گفتگو برای جریان گفتگو بسازید
2. طعم حرفه ای
Rasa Pro که قبلا به عنوان Rasa X شناخته می شد، یک لایه اضافی در بالای منبع باز Rasa است. برای کمک به شما طراحی شده است:
-
حاشیه نویسی داده ها
-
دستیار خود را در زمان واقعی آزمایش کنید
-
با اعضای تیم همکاری کنید
-
دستیار خود را در تولید مستقر و نظارت کنید
رسا پرو: https://rasa.com/docs/rasa/rasa-pro/
رسا چگونه کار می کند؟
معماری رسا بر اساس دو ویژگی اصلی است: درک زبان طبیعی (NLU) و مدیریت گفتگو بیایید آن را تجزیه کنیم:
1. درک زبان طبیعی (NLU)
NLU به چت بات کمک می کند تا بفهمد کاربر چه می گوید. مشخص می کند:
-
مقاصد: هدف پشت پیام کاربر (به عنوان مثال، رزرو پرواز، سفارش غذا).
-
نهادها: اطلاعات کلیدی در پیام (به عنوان مثال، تاریخ، نام، مکان).
به عنوان مثال، در پیام «رزرو پرواز به نیویورک در روز دوشنبه»، ممکن است هدف «book_flight» باشد و موجودیتها شامل «نیویورک» (مقصد) و «دوشنبه» (تاریخ) باشند.
2. مدیریت گفتگو
هنگامی که ربات قصد کاربر را درک کرد، مدیریت گفتگو تصمیم می گیرد که ربات چگونه باید پاسخ دهد. این شامل:
-
پیروی از قوانین از پیش تعریف شده
-
استفاده از سیاستهای یادگیری ماشین برای مدیریت مکالمات پویا و چند نوبتی
Rasa این دو قابلیت را برای ایجاد یک تجربه مکالمه یکپارچه ترکیب می کند. 😊
موارد استفاده از راسا
انعطاف پذیری راسا آن را برای طیف وسیعی از کاربردها مناسب می کند، از جمله:
-
پشتیبانی مشتری: سوالات متداول را خودکار کنید و پشتیبانی فوری ارائه دهید.
-
تجارت الکترونیک: در توصیه های محصول و پیگیری سفارش کمک کنید.
-
بهداشت و درمان: قرار ملاقات ها را برنامه ریزی کنید و نکات بهداشتی را ارائه دهید.
-
تحصیلات: به دانشآموزان در پرسشها کمک کنید و منابع آموزشی را تهیه کنید.
امکانات بی پایان هستند! 🌟
نتیجه گیری
Rasa یک پلت فرم قدرتمند برای ساخت هوش مصنوعی مکالمه ای است که هم انعطاف پذیر و هم قوی است. چه مبتدی یا یک توسعهدهنده با تجربه باشید، طبیعت منبع باز و پشتیبانی جامعه Rasa آن را به انتخابی عالی برای ایجاد چتباتها و دستیاران مجازی تبدیل کرده است. 🌐
برای شروع آماده اید؟ امروز Rasa را نصب کنید و خلاقیت خود را در ساخت دستیار بزرگ هوش مصنوعی بعدی آزاد کنید. کد نویسی مبارک! 💻
مراجع